Output 81aa5e5a1f2a01b94be8f5aa2953537d5a8da3f89ecbca0bb046e158bee56dd2:107

value
287465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999c9b0b91d1a2534db9ce1462e8dae449558b68 OP_EQUAL
address
3FhEv3Yy53UpcUD2zj3GYstgme1QaLmsr3
transaction
81aa5e5a1f2a01b94be8f5aa2953537d5a8da3f89ecbca0bb046e158bee56dd2